What I do is download spc soundfiles from the Internet (they range from 200kB to 5000kB) and with a winamp plugin (snesAmp) play the tracks through winamp.
Interestingly, winamp comes with a plugin of its own (Nullsoft Disk Writer), where you can save anything you play in WAV (and I assume mp3) format - including these spc files to a common directory on your hard drive.
You can find different plugins for different systems, but I can't currently get some of the plugins to work properly (snesAmp is solid, and is working perfectly), though for convenience I'd probably have a look at "http://gh.ffshrine.org/".
